logo

Output dec21b159dfa5b8f9b52204805210c0af90001f48890059705e10623bb202a1b:0

value
1038000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8703d84a5a463e1709a03bdac6145ca4ce9d9de6 OP_EQUALVERIFY OP_CHECKSIG
address
1DJtq3aFbAuKtHqc5VFTeLtQSBNxtB2Dui
transaction
dec21b159dfa5b8f9b52204805210c0af90001f48890059705e10623bb202a1b